Louisiana Links Day at the Capitol: The State of the Black Woman in Louisiana
Louisiana Links members gathered at the state capitol in Baton Rouge on April 23, 2023 for Louisiana Links Day at the Capitol. It was a day to educate and advocate with legislators on issues of particular concern to our organization - breast health, human trafficking, and the foster care system....

INSPIRE NOLA Read Aloud Day at Alice Harte
The New Orleans (LA) Chapter of The Links, Incorporated participated in INSPIRE NOLA Read Aloud Day at Alice Harte School. One example of the many activities the chapter is involved in throughout the New Orleans community.
